Frequently Asked Questions about Cobleskill

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cobleskill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cobleskill ranges from $875 to $2,870 with an average monthly rent of $1,652.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cobleskill c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cobleskill range from $1,175 to $3,450.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,009.

How expensive are Cobleskill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 16 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cobleskill on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,275 to $2,625 - averaging $2,111 for the location.
